Output 6e5b3a56e4d664ec09f1ad65fddea2bf79ebafd96fa2c74537b5bb87bfef79e8:0

value
59254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0664546675e4db4a34d308b3a0ca7da4d44bd04e OP_EQUAL
address
32GpAivmtTnZg6ZtKwNyTxXVEE1gBen4GQ
transaction
6e5b3a56e4d664ec09f1ad65fddea2bf79ebafd96fa2c74537b5bb87bfef79e8
confirmations
145610
spent
true